访谈详情

1. 您为什么选择从事相关的领域研究?

I chose to work in antennas and applied electromagnetics because this field combines strong theoretical foundations with direct technological applications, from wireless communications to sensing. The possibility of contributing to both fundamental methods and real-world solutions has always fascinated me.

 

2. 您目前从事的研究工作有哪些?

Currently, my research focuses on antennas and propagation, with particular emphasis on reflectarray antennas, reconfigurable intelligent surfaces, metamaterial absorbers, array synthesis techniques, and RF energy harvesting.

 

3. 您认为五年后该领域的研究重点将会是什么?

In the next years, I believe research will focus on intelligent and reconfigurable antenna systems, AI-driven design, and metamaterial-based devices for 6G and advanced sensing.

编委介绍

Francesca Venneri  助理教授

意大利卡拉布里亚大学

  • Dr. Francesca Venneri received the degree in information technology engineering from the University of Calabria, Italy, in 1998 and the Ph.D. degree in electronic engineering from the University “Mediterranea” of Reggio Calabria in 2002. Currently, she is an Assistant Professor at the University of Calabria. Her research interests focus on microstrip reflectarrays, antenna analysis and synthesis, reflecting intelligent surfaces, RFID technology, metamaterial absorbers. She is member of the IEEE Antennas and Propagation Society, the IEEE Microwave Theory and Techniques Society, the IEEE Electromagnetic Compatibility Society, the SIEm (Società Italiana di Elettromagnetismo) and the CNIT (Consorzio Consorzio Nazionale Interuniversitario per le Telecomunicazioni).
